Transaction 8824686ef23050f33a926c700b3f2b4088a25525015b9838c07434bb08d03fa3
1 Input
2 Outputs
- 8824686ef23050f33a926c700b3f2b4088a25525015b9838c07434bb08d03fa3:0
- 8824686ef23050f33a926c700b3f2b4088a25525015b9838c07434bb08d03fa3:1
value 252083
address 13jYx76U4Jg6MHQUd7p1mFFkcgmhUAWk56
value 751734
address 16sqeH3mo6KgmARNQF2NpXrUPfPwiNJZcd